Job Description

Job Summary: The Lead Trauma Registrar is responsible for the integrity of collection, analysis, entry, completion, and validation of all patients meeting inclusion criteria into the hospital trauma registry daily. The Lead Trauma Registrar will also ensure delivery of Trauma Center data to the North Carolina Office of EMS, and internal CaroMont Regional Medical Center departments to maintain trauma center designation. The Lead Trauma Registrar will establish processes for data concurrency and data validation to ensure that the databases are not only current, but accurate. The Lead Trauma Registrar will assist in the training of the Trauma Registrars to ensure maximum utilization of individual and group capabilities. The Lead Trauma Registrar should also maintain knowledge of all rules, regulations, laws, and guidelines that impact or govern the Trauma Registry and ensure that CaroMont Regional Medical Center is in compliance. This position reports to the manager of Trauma Services.

Qualifications: Bachelor’s degree in computer science or healthcare field required. Completion of ICD-10 Coding Program or equivalent experience. Completion of Association for the Advancement of Automotive Medicine (AAAM) Abbreviated Injury Scale (AIS) Coder Training required within 6 months of hire. Completion of the American Trauma Society’s Trauma Registrar Course or equivalent provided by a state trauma program required within 6 months of hire. A minimum of two (2) years’ experience working with trauma registry databases and report writing is required for the Lead Registrar title. Extensive knowledge of registry maintenance, related regulations, and data abstraction procedures. Proficient in medical terminology, anatomy, and physiology. Certified Abbreviated Injury Scale Specialist (CAISS) or Certified Specialist in Trauma Registries (CSTR) required within one year
